Factors to Consider When Choosing Automatic Pool Cleaners For Above Ground Pools
Selecting an automatic pool cleaner for above ground pools involves weighing several important factors. Beyond basic features, understanding how each element impacts your experience can help you avoid common pitfalls and choose a machine that truly fits your pool’s size and your cleaning needs.Cleaning Performance and Coverage
Look for models with strong suction power and efficient navigation, especially if your pool has steps or corners. The best cleaners can cover the entire pool surface, including walls and waterlines, without missing spots. Consider the debris capacity—larger baskets or tanks mean less frequent emptying, which is especially useful for pools with lots of leaves or dirt. Keep in mind that some models excel at floor cleaning but struggle with walls or waterlines, so match the model’s strengths to your pool’s specific needs.
Runtime and Battery Life
Longer runtime reduces the number of recharges needed per cleaning cycle, making maintenance more efficient. Most cordless models offer between 1.5 to 3 hours of operation; consider your pool size and typical debris load to choose appropriately. Shorter runtimes might require multiple sessions or more frequent recharging, which can be inconvenient. Battery life and charging times are also important—look for fast-charging models if you want quick turnaround between cleaning sessions.
Navigation Technology
Advanced navigation features—such as sonar, smart sensors, or track drive—help cleaners efficiently cover the entire pool surface and avoid obstacles. Cheaper models often use random movement, which can leave areas uncleaned or require multiple passes. More sophisticated navigation reduces cleaning time and improves coverage, especially in pools with complex shapes or steps. Consider whether the model’s navigation system suits your pool’s layout for best results.
Ease of Use and Maintenance
Features like app control, remote operation, and auto-docking simplify operation and storage. Look for models with easy filter access and straightforward cleaning cycles to minimize maintenance effort. Cordless models eliminate the hassle of hoses and cords, but check how easy it is to clean or replace filters. Keep in mind that more complex controls may have a learning curve, so prioritize user-friendly interfaces if you prefer simplicity.
Build Quality and Durability
Since these cleaners operate in wet environments, waterproofing and robust construction are essential. Models with IPX8 waterproof ratings tend to be more reliable and resistant to damage. Also, consider the quality of hoses, brushes, and wheels—durable materials reduce the need for repairs over time. While premium models often have better build quality, weigh whether the extra investment aligns with your pool frequency and cleaning needs.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can these cordless pool cleaners handle large debris like leaves?
Many cordless pool cleaners are equipped with larger debris baskets and powerful suction to manage leaves and larger debris, but performance varies. For pools with heavy leaf accumulation, look for models with high debris capacity and strong suction power. Regularly emptying the basket during cleaning can prevent clogs and maintain optimal suction. If your pool often has lots of debris, consider models specifically designed for heavy-duty cleaning to avoid frequent interruptions.
How long do these battery-powered cleaners typically last per charge?
Most battery-powered pool cleaners offer between 1.5 to 3 hours of runtime on a full charge. Longer runtimes are beneficial for larger pools or thorough cleaning, reducing the need for multiple cycles. Some models feature fast-charging capabilities, allowing them to recharge in under two hours. Keep in mind that actual runtime can be affected by the debris load, water conditions, and operational settings, so choose a model that matches your pool size and cleaning frequency.
Are cordless pool cleaners suitable for all pool shapes?
Yes, many cordless models are designed with flexible navigation systems that adapt to various pool shapes, including those with steps or irregular outlines. Advanced navigation technology, such as sonar or track drive, enhances coverage and minimizes missed spots. However, simpler or budget models may struggle with complex layouts, leaving some areas uncleaned. Consider your pool’s shape and complexity when selecting a model to ensure comprehensive cleaning.
How often should I clean or replace the filters on these cleaners?
Filter maintenance depends on usage and debris load, but generally, filters should be checked after each cleaning session. If your pool has heavy debris, filters may need cleaning more frequently—perhaps weekly. Most models feature easy-to-access filters that can be rinsed with water, extending their lifespan. Replacing filters is usually needed every few months or as recommended by the manufacturer, especially if filters become damaged or clogged beyond cleaning.
Is it worth investing in a more expensive model with advanced features?
Investing in a higher-end model with advanced features like smart navigation, longer runtime, and app control can greatly improve cleaning efficiency and convenience. These models tend to require less manual intervention, cover more area in less time, and are often more durable. However, if your pool is small, lightly used, or you prefer simple operation, a budget-friendly option might suffice. Weigh the added benefits against your specific needs and budget before deciding.
